Adenosylcobalamin-Dependent Ribonucleotide Reductases

Ribonucleotide reductases with an absolute requirement for adenosyl-cobalamin (Fig. 1) as a coenzyme have been demonstrated only in microorganisms (7). Numerous analogs of adenosylcobalamin have been tested for their ability to replace or to inhibit the action of the coenzyme in the adenosyl-cobalamin-dependent ribonucleotide reductase reaction the enzyme from L. leichmannii has been used in most of these studies. Kinetic studies have been used in most investigations of analog-enzyme interactions and thus the interpretation of data regarding the affinity of analogs for the reductase is subject to the limitations imposed on kinetic studies of a complex reaction. [Pg.51]

With one exception, the known B12-requiring reactions involve either (1) methyl group transfer or (2) adenosylcobalamin-dependent isomerizations. The isomerizations exchange a carbon-bound hydrogen with another carbon-bound functional group as shown here. The one exception is an intermolecular transfer reaction catalyzed by a ribonucleotide reductase of Lactobacillus. [Pg.446]
